Karachi Board postponed intermediate exams, advertised new date

Listen to article

The Board of Directors of Middle Education Karachi (BIEK) announced the postponement of the annual intermediate surveys for 2025, originally scheduled to start on April 28.

The samples now begin from May 5th.

The decision was made according to directives from the chairman of the board and quoted two main reasons for the delay.

First, the ongoing process of awarding Grace Marks in Mathematics, Chemistry and Physics for 2024 first-year science pre-medicine, pre-enginering and general science groups has not yet been completed.

Secondly, several exam centers are still concerned with matriculation exams, which began on April 8 and will continue until May 8.

Officials said the overlap necessitated adjustments to maintain the examination system’s organization and ensure center accessibility.

Students, educational institutions and parents have been asked to continue preparations according to the new schedule.

BIEK stated that any additional updates or changes would be communicated through its official site (www.biek.edu.pk) and its verified social media pages on Facebook and Instagram.

Yesterday, Sindh Government’s Department of Universities and Boards issued an official review that gave Grace Marks to students who appear in the intermediate part-in (pre-medicine and pre-engineering) annual studies of 2024.

The message was issued after approval of the provincial cabinet during its meeting held on April 15. According to the directive, students will receive 20% grace marks in chemistry and 15% in both physics and mathematics.

The Karachi Board of Intermediate Education has been informed of the decision and implementation instructions have been issued accordingly.

The announcement, signed by Sharifuddin, section officer for boards of the Department of Universities and Boards, instructs the chairman of the intermediate board of directors Karachi to continue with the necessary events to use Cabinet’s decision.

It is important to note that the Karachi intermediate board currently does not have a permanent chairman. The position is temporarily owned by the chairman of the Karachi Matriculation Board.
